Environmental and economic problems of nature management in subsoil development
Authors:
Abstract
Environmental and social factors of rational use of subsoil involves the implementation of a number of measures to preserve natural resources for future generations; to ensure safety conditions in mining operations and the use of scientific and technological progress to facilitate the work of miners; to maintain a favorable to public health ecologically safe natural environmen.
